Abstract
The utility model discloses a high-speed grounding switch of a high-voltage composite electric appliance. The switch comprises a movable contact, a static contact, a guiding shaft fixed on a first housing, a grounding insulator, an outer connecting lever connected with an external operating mechanism, an inner connecting lever, a transmission shaft, a connection board, a T-shaped driving frame, and an insulating tube. The high-speed grounding switch realizes transmission of triangular arrangement through the T-shaped driving frame, and compared with conventional linear arrangement, internal structure is simplified, and production cost is reduced. Through arranging the insulating tube between the movable contact and the T-shaped driving frame, insulated isolation of the movable contact and the transmission system is realized, so switching-on and switching-off of the high-speed grounding switch of the high-voltage composite electric appliance are more stable, and meanwhile integrated dimensions and floor space are reduced.

Background technology
Fully closed combined electric unit is called for short GIS earthed switch and adopts three-phase combined type structure, fills SF6 gas-insulated, can be divided into trip service earthed switch and high speed grounding switch by purposes.When equipment normally moves, ground connection fracture disconnects, and in the time needing to overhaul in circuit, after switch fracture to be isolated disconnects, earthed switch closes, thereby guarantees to need maintenance position reliable ground.Trip service earthed switch is equipped with motor drive mechanism, high speed grounding switch is equipped with electric spring mechanism, and high speed grounding switch requires to possess the ability of folding em induced current and static induced current at course of action, the synchronism of three-phase folding must guarantee in the setting of product technology condition simultaneously.Institute's distribution actuation mechanism has the features such as volume is little, simple in structure, and its overall dimension is little, is conducive to reduce the overall dimensions of whole GIS.

Embodiment
There is understanding and understanding further for ease of the technological means to the utility model and operation, be elaborated as follows below in conjunction with specific embodiment.
Shown in seeing figures.1.and.2, the present embodiment provides a kind of high speed grounding switch of high-voltage combined electrical apparatus, comprises moving contact 1, fixed contact 2, is fixed on the axis of guide 3, ground insulation 4, the outer connecting lever 5 being connected with outside operating mechanism, interior connecting lever 6, power transmission shaft 7, connecting plate 8, T shape gear frame 9 and insulated tube 13 on the first housing 10.T shape gear frame 9 adopts duralumin material in the present embodiment, the axis of guide 3 adopts steel alloy material and through modified, blackening process, effectively guaranteed contact point, impulsive force in making process.
Wherein, power transmission shaft 7 one end are fixedly connected with outer connecting lever 5, and the other end of power transmission shaft 7 is connected with the first housing 10 axles, the middle part of power transmission shaft 7 and interior connecting lever 6 chain connections; Interior connecting lever 6 is connected with connecting plate 8 one end axles, and connecting plate 8 other ends are connected with T shape gear frame 9 axles; Moving contact 1 one end is connected with contact base 11 plugs, and moving contact 1 other end is connected with insulated tube 13 threaded one ends through quiet only 2; In quiet only 2 holes, the guide ring 18 that moving contact 1 is led is set, the spring touch finger 12 contacting with moving contact 1 is set in quiet only 2 holes; Joint 16 one end are fixedly connected with T shape gear frame 9, and the other end is threaded with insulated tube 13; Contact base 11 is connected with the disk insulator 15 that is fixed on second housing 14 one end by screw; T shape gear frame 9 is slidably connected with the axis of guide 3; Moving contact 1 is connected with ground insulation 4 with copper bar 17 by spring touch finger 12, and ground insulation 4 that is provided with earthing bar 20 is fixed on the first housing 10 by screw.
In the present embodiment, outer connecting lever 5 and interior connecting lever 6 are " ㄇ " form, and interior connecting lever 6 is provided with the first trip bolt 19 for fastening power transmission shaft 3, and outer connecting lever 5 is provided with the second trip bolt 19 ' for fastening power transmission shaft 3.
Because the cross section of power transmission shaft 7 is pentagon or hexagon, therefore power transmission shaft 7 is hard connections with outer connecting lever 5 and interior connecting lever 6.The two ends of the axis of guide 3 are connected with the first housing 10 pins respectively.In the present embodiment, the first housing 10 and the second housing 14 are connected by screw, and are provided with sealing ring between the two.In addition, have the each parts that are connected all to adopt sealing ring to seal with the first housing 10 or the second housing 14, sealing mode is known by persons skilled in the art, does not repeat them here.
The operation principle brief description of the high speed grounding switch of the high-voltage combined electrical apparatus described in above-mentioned the present embodiment as:
Close a floodgate: drive power transmission shaft 7 by the outer connecting lever 5 of operating mechanism, power transmission shaft 7 drives again interior connecting lever 6, interior connecting lever 6 drives T shape gear frame 9 by effect connecting plate 8, thereby T shape gear frame 9 drives through sliding on the axis of guide 3 moving contact 5 being threaded with insulated tube 13, make moving contact 5 be plugged into the combined floodgate of the interior earthed switch of realizing combined electrical apparatus of contact base 11, as shown in Figure 1.Three-phase induction electric current in combined electrical apparatus or fault current warp successfully can be imported to the earth with ground insulation 13 earthing bars that are connected 20 like this.
Separating brake: drive power transmission shaft 7 by the outer connecting lever 5 of operating mechanism, power transmission shaft 7 drives again interior connecting lever 6, interior connecting lever 6 drives T shape gear frame 9 by effect connecting plate 8, thereby T shape gear frame 9 drives through sliding on the axis of guide 3 moving contact 5 being threaded with insulated tube 13, make moving contact 5 separate the separating brake of the earthed switch of realizing combined electrical apparatus with contact base 11, as shown in Figure 3.
In the present embodiment, T shape gear frame 9 through the high speed grounding switch of above-mentioned high-voltage combined electrical apparatus point, close a floodgate after on the axis of guide 3 sliding distance be not less than 85mm.
